Output fb07ae53aefa7427ecea815d4366f06999c822709723a107cbe4d4802535df60:1

value
1002070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c623429308d33109ba37195f34f312ee2587ed2d OP_EQUAL
address
3KkfxSM63qHKpnwMtJsnht31yQfreZDhvP
transaction
fb07ae53aefa7427ecea815d4366f06999c822709723a107cbe4d4802535df60
confirmations
237491
spent
true